Stanton’s Door

It was a simple suggestion by his teacher that caused Roger Remquist to start his journal. She said it would help him deal with his life. Merely one day into the journal, he would meet Scarlotte Bairn, and his life would begin to change drastically.

Roger soon discovered that he couldn’t win and Scarlotte couldn’t win. They would never be allowed to be together. Standing in their path were two mothers, five families, and an influential organization with a powerful secret to protect, a secret more than a hundred-twenty years old.

The Stanton mansion has held a secret that had altered the lives of the wealthy, influenced politics, and changed the course of a nation, but they had never faced a real threat to their continuing domination.

Two teenagers would cause that to change. A meeting outside the Stanton mansion gate would start a relationship that would set in motion a series of events that would threaten to topple an organization which would do anything to survive and protect its power.

However, it is not just the external struggle Roger and Scarlotte must face; there is also an internal conflict to resolve and an even deeper secret.
